About 250 High Street North

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

250 High Street North is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Dunstable (LU6 1BE). It has a recorded floor area of 80 m² (around 861 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(January 2019)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

Across 2007–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£376,000 is 26.6%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£345/sq ft) was about 79.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: September 2019 at £297,000.
